Spectral Properties of Continuous Refinement Operators

نویسندگان

  • R. Q. JIA
  • S. L. LEE
  • A. SHARMA
چکیده

This paper studies the spectrum of continuous refinement operators and relates their spectral properties with the solutions of the corresponding continuous refinement equations.
